Lost Your Mercedes Key? Replacement Options & Costs

Losing your Benz key can be a major headache, but thankfully, you have several replacement alternatives. The expense of a replacement key can differ considerably depending on your vehicle and its age . You can typically turn to a nearby Mercedes-Benz dealer who can create a new key, though this is usually the highest option, often priced between $300 and $600. Alternatively, independent auto technicians who focus in automotive keys may offer a better affordable option , potentially near the $150 - $400 range. Finally, some internet key replacement services can be found, though their performance should be carefully investigated before proceeding; these generally request somewhere between $100 and $350. Remember that coding the key to your Mercedes's computer is almost always necessary and can add to the overall bill .

Replacing a Mercedes Key: Fob, Smart Key, and Traditional

Losing your Mercedes key can be a significant headache, but fortunately replacement options exist for all varieties of Mercedes fobs. Whether you have a traditional metal key, a sophisticated smart key with remote functionality, or a key remote for unlocking and starting, the replacement process differs. Traditional blanks can often be duplicated at a local hardware store, while smart keys and key controls typically require programming by a qualified specialist or automotive locksmith, which involves a charge and can take some time. How Much Does a Mercedes Key Replacement Really Cost?

Figuring out the expense of a Mercedes key replacement can be a challenge, with amounts varying considerably depending on several elements. Generally, you can assume to pay anywhere from $200 to $600, but this is just a rough range. The sort of transponder is the biggest factor; a simple standard key is typically the least costly, while a complex key with capabilities like remote entry and security functionality will run you significantly greater. Here's a quick breakdown:

  • Dealer Replacement: $300 - $600+ (includes matching and maybe higher labor rates)
  • Locksmith: $150 - $400 (can be less expensive, but verify programming abilities)
  • Online Retailers: $50 - $200 (just the fob blank; requires matching which can be tricky and may need a professional tool)

Remember to consider coding fees – Mercedes keys need specialized equipment to be programmed to your vehicle. Finally, a missing key may require additional anti-theft measures and reprogramming of existing keys, adding to the overall cost.
